    Summary:
    Bento opens to address book instead of last database used
    Bento product:
    Bento for Mac
    Bento version:
    4.0.7
    Operating system version:
    10.7.3
    Description of the issue:
    When opening Bento,Bento switches from the last app used to the Address Book database. This wastes our time since most often we need to get into the last database used - NOT THE ADDRESS BOOK! Please fix this.
    Steps to reproduce the problem:
    open Bento after quitting Bento in any database except address book.
    Expected result:
    Bento should open to the last database used. e.g. passwords
    Actual result:
    Bento will reopen and initially show the last database used but then it will make you wait as it switches to the address book.

      Bento will default to the last library that was used. The exception to this rule is if data in Address Book has changed. If any data is changed or added to Address Book between launches of Bento, the default library will be Address Book when opening.  Are you currently subscribed to any type of server that updates your Address Book?

      If possible, could you select a library then quit and re-launch Bento without making changes to Address Book to see if the correct library is selected on open.
